Comprehending the EB-5 Program Fundamentals



The EB-5 Immigrant Capitalist Program uses a pathway to U.S. permanent residency via financial investment in job-creating business. Your investment should create or maintain at the very least ten full-time work for United state workers within 2 years.


Recognizing the program's framework is considerable. You'll be working with U.S. Citizenship and Migration Solutions (USCIS) and must send Type I-526, Immigrant Petition by Alien Capitalist, to start the procedure. After authorization, you can look for conditional residency. It is necessary to make certain your investment satisfies all essential requirements, as USCIS carefully assesses these applications. Getting acquainted with the EB-5 program can assist you make notified decisions and navigate the procedure successfully.


Determining Eligible Financial Investment Opportunities



Exactly how can you ensure that your investment aligns with the EB-5 program demands? Start by investigating projects that are assigned as EB-5 eligible. Try to find investments in a Targeted Employment Location (TEA), where the minimum financial investment is reduced to $900,000. Validate that the task is linked to a Regional Facility, as these entities are pre-approved by USCIS, simplifying your trip.


Next, assess the company strategy and work creation capacity; your financial investment should create at the very least 10 full time jobs for united state employees. Do not think twice to request for documents showing the task's practicality and conformity with EB-5 standards.


Ultimately, speak with an immigration lawyer specialized in EB-5 to identify you're making an informed choice. By adhering to these actions, you'll boost your possibilities of finding an ideal investment opportunity that meets all EB-5 requirements and collections you on the course to success.

Browsing the Regional Center Option



When you pick the Regional Center alternative for your EB-5 financial investment, you're using a pathway that can streamline the process while possibly optimizing your task creation influence - eb5 lawyer. Regional Centers are assigned by USCIS and concentrate on particular tasks, typically in targeted locations where job creation is a concern. This implies you can invest in a bigger project, like a resort or mixed-use development, without having to handle the original source it directly

The Duty of Job Production in Your Application



Work production is a crucial part of your EB-5 application, as it straight affects your eligibility. You need to show just how your financial investment will result in new jobs in the united state Recognizing exactly how to determine this job influence can substantially enhance your situation.

Determining Work Influence



When you want to determine the work influence of your EB-5 investment, you'll need to offer concrete proof that your task will certainly create or protect the called for 10 permanent jobs. Start by establishing a detailed service plan that outlines your forecasts. This plan ought to include thorough economic projections, hiring timelines, and work descriptions to show how your job will certainly create employment. Use market criteria and data to support your insurance claims, showing exactly how similar tasks have actually succeeded in job creation. Engage with an experienced EB-5 regional facility or financial professional to assure precision and compliance. Bear in mind, the more durable and practical your work production method is, the stronger your application will be, ultimately raising your opportunities of success in the EB-5 procedure.
